Output 2dc3e62177b24da2bdd35f260f86ae036d8c1507cd1de3b3712de3da5aae67ad:0

value
1521975
script pubkey
OP_0 OP_PUSHBYTES_20 8bba9bcd53643e9f02a03775bd5d5df08b218e9d
address
bc1q3wafhn2nvslf7q4qxa6m6h2a7z9jrr5am659az
transaction
2dc3e62177b24da2bdd35f260f86ae036d8c1507cd1de3b3712de3da5aae67ad